Prologue
My name is Rachel Barbra Berry.
I'm twenty-eight years old.
According to the United States of America law, I've committed voluntary manslaughter, In other words…
I've killed someone.
Now she's stuck at Bayview Correctional Facility for nine years.
Nine freaking years, that's one hundred and eight months. That's three thousand-two hundred and forty days, God knows how many hours.
She has been here a whole five minutes and she hates it already.
She saw the looks the other inmates were giving her and she almost hated them for looking at her with that knowing look.
'Right there, another one of us' that's what that… sorry excuse of female human beings is thinking.
But she's not another inmate; she's a star, a bright shinning star; A star that is locked in a cage, hidden in a place where she can't shine.
Yeah, she's depressed, wanna know why?
Broadway gave her standing ovations; countless amounts of people clapped each and every single one of her performances. The cheers, the admiration, the awards, the joy of her life, it was all taken away from her.
Just because of a stupid crush.
You may think that she's an idiot for risking it all for a man, but she isn't. Because she may be a star now, she may have lived in an Upper East Side penthouse with a perfect view of Central Park, she may be a diva or fashion example for today's women. But deep down inside she's the same girl from the Bronx who no one ever took a second glance and was mocked for her big nose, her second-hand clothes and her dreams of success.
She's the same girl whose father abandoned and whose junky mother never cared about, the same insecure teenage girl who cried herself to sleep because no boy would kiss her. And even though she went to LaGuardia High School and got her first boyfriend and eventually Juilliard gave her a scholarship and the dream came true, she never experienced that thing.
Love.
Finn Hudson was the first boy who ever admired her and who told her those precious three words, and even when sometimes she felt like he wanted to hide their relationship, she never felt any less loved. He was so perfect and dreamy, why trying to ruin the only chance she could ever had with a nice guy?
So what if his brother was her main enemy and she never met the rest of his family? So what if they had only being together for two months before her incarceration? So what if sometimes he gave her all those back-handed compliments and sometimes forgot their dates?
She still would've done everything for him.
What a stupid girl she was.
She had told him, 'I would die for you'. Apparently he took it as 'I would kill for you'. But that was over now.
It was time to move on and put her plans into action.
During the time of the trials, when she had realized how blind she had been all along, especially about him, she had taken a decision.
She would behave as perfectly as possible during her time in prison and try to get released from jail before; her lawyer told her it was a possibility.
After that, she would give herself a few years to try to make it back to Broadway, and if that doesn't happen, then she will make a plan to dedicate to something else and live her life away from shinning lights and marquees with her name.
As she lays in her bunk, the moonlight making it's way into the cell by the small window (with bars of course), thinking of the man who put her here. Not Kurt Hummel, may he rest in peace, nor Finn Hudson, may he die a painful death please. No, she's thinking about Noah Puckerman. Finn's best friend and for a short amount of time, someone she considered a friendly acquaintance.
She hates that man with all her might.
She hates him because he's too blind to see what kind of man his best friend is
She hates Detective Noah Puckerman because he sent her to jail for a crime she did not commit.
